Repairing a pier and beam foundation can be a substantial investment, with costs fluctuating widely depending on several key factors. The severity of the damage is a primary determinant. Minor settling may only require a few piers, while significant structural issues could necessitate extensive repairs involving beams, concrete, and even soil modification. Location also plays a role, with labor costs varying significantly across regions. Additionally, the availability of the foundation can impact the overall cost, as challenging terrain or tight spaces may require specialized equipment and expertise. It's crucial to obtain multiple estimates from reputable contractors specializing in pier and beam foundation repair. Don't hesitate to ask about their experience, warranties, and payment plans. Thoroughly reviewing the extent of work outlined in each quote will help you make an informed decision. Determining the expense of pier and beam foundation repair can be a bit like deciphering a complex puzzle. Several key elements come into play, impacting the overall figure. The magnitude of the damage is a primary aspect, with larger repairs naturally requiring more materials and labor. The reach of the affected area also influences pricing, as difficult-to-reach locations may require additional equipment. Soil types play a significant role too. Difficult soil compositions can make repairs more demanding, driving up the aggregate expense. Finally, the region where the repair is needed can impact prices due to local labor and material costs.
